Fraudulent Claim Prevention

Detection

Fraudulent claim prevention within cryptocurrency, options, and derivatives markets centers on identifying anomalous transaction patterns and deviations from established behavioral norms. Sophisticated surveillance systems employ statistical analysis and machine learning to flag potentially illicit activity, focusing on velocity of trades, unusual order sizes, and discrepancies in reported positions. Real-time monitoring of on-chain data and exchange order books is crucial, alongside the implementation of robust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) protocols to verify user identities and source of funds.
